Ripjaws run fine in amd rigs, they just need to be manually set to the right voltage/timings/frequency and many people don't realize that and get mad when their ram isn't running at the rated speed automatically.

Also AM3 is limited to 1600 and many people buy the 2000 thinking they can get it to run at 2000 when in reality its the chipset's limitation not the RAM's.
